Staff

Our Physios have extensive knowledge of Sports and Musculoskeletal Physiotherapy. Our Physios ensure a thorough biomechanical assessment and work directly with you to ensure an effective structured program for proper rehabilitation. They tailor gym and hydrotherapy programs for functional retraining and strength & conditioning. They currently provide health and rehabilitation services for Rostrevor Old Collegians Football Club in Division 1 Amateurs, Unley Jets Football Club in Divsion 2 Amateurs, East Torrens District Cricket Club playing in the SACA Grade Cricket Competition, Morialta Uniting Netball Club and the Southern Tigers in SA District Basketball.

Wahib Joubeir

Senior Sports + Musculoskeletal Physiotherapy
Wahib has been a physiotherapist since 2000 and has a Masters in Sports and Musculoskeletal Physiotherapy achieved from the University of South Australia in 2003. He is involved with numerous local football, soccer, cricket and basketball community clubs as their Senior Physiotherapist. Wahib is also Clinical Educator for the University of South Australia’s School of Physiotherapy Undergradute and Post-Graduate programs. His areas of interest are in the management of complex pain disorders, biomechanical assessment & management of chronic musculoskeletal presentations, post-surgical rehabilitation of shoulder, hip and knee procedures, and implementation of evidence-based guidelines for improving health outcomes in adolescent and elderly populations.

Jack O'Leary

Sports and Exercise Physiotherapy
Jack is an accomplished physiotherapist with a wealth of experience and a passion for helping patients achieve their goals. After graduating from the University of South Australia in 2015, Jack gained two years of clinical experience in private practice on the Yorke Peninsula. In 2018, he joined the Kinetic team and has recently become an APA Titled Sports and Exercise Physiotherapist after completing his post-graduate Masters of Sports and Exercise Physiotherapy from La Trobe University.

Jack's approach to clinical work is grounded in evidence-based practices and a well-rounded methodology. He loves getting people moving and lifting in his hydrotherapy and gym classes, and is also skilled in manual therapy techniques that aid rehabilitation.

While sports physiotherapy is an area of particular interest for Jack, he also has a deep passion for working with patients who experience persistent pain. He believes in empowering his patients through education, providing clear explanations, and creating individualized rehabilitation plans that address their unique needs. These components are crucial when treating persistent pain and are at the heart of Jack's patient-centred approach.

When he’s not working, Jack enjoys playing football for the Payneham Norwood Union Football Club and catching some waves down south.

Ben Slade

Physiotherapy
Ben graduated from University of South Australia with a Bachelor’s of Physiotherapy in 2018, and has been working closely with local sporting clubs since 2015. He has previous experience working as a physio in a strength and conditioning facility, helping athletes maximise their sporting performance.

He has a keen interest in an active, exercise-based approach to managing pain and injury, and loves helping people understand how to self-manage their conditions to reach their goals.

Sport and exercise are not Ben’s only interests, he enjoys helping people from all walks of life, particularly those who have been experiencing persistent pain. Ben values taking the time to listen to his client’s story to fully understand their goals and the challenges they deal with, providing a thorough assessment to identify the changes that can be made.

Ben’s spare time is mostly taken up with his own sport or training in the gym. He has grown a passion for netball and basketball, and has been fortunate enough to represent South Australia in the men’s state netball team.

Kate Dansie

Podiatry
Kate holds a Bachelor of Applied Science in Exercise and Sports Science as well as a Bachelor of Applied Science in Podiatry.

Kate has worked as a Rehabilitation Exercise Consultant for 6 years and she has been working in both the public and private sectors as a Podiatrist for over 26 years.

Kate has a special interest in biomechanical analysis and correction of foot posture using rehabilitation exercises and custom made orthotic devices. Podiatry services at Kinetic aim to keep the whole family active with healthy feet. Kate holds a membership with the Australian Podiatry Association.

Kunal Shah

Orthotist and Prosthetist C-OP, AOPA

After graduating as a Physiotherapist in 2005 Kunal’s love for making things and serving people encourage him to delve into this unique profession. Kunal graduated from La Trobe University in 2010 with a Bachelor of Prosthetics and Orthotics.

Since graduating Kunal has worked as an Orthotist and Prosthetist at several public hospitals and rehabilitation facilities in South Australia, gaining expertise in

  • Manufacturing and fitting of orthotics devices
  • Orthotics management of complex foot & ankle
  • Orthotics management of spinal injuries
  • Diabetic feet management
  • Orthotics management of neuromuscular and neurological disorders
  • Lower limb prosthetics rehabilitation
  • Neurological rehabilitation
  • Paediatrics orthotics management.

Kunal has special interest in clinical gait analysis and complex lower limb Orthotic management with clinical experience and expertise in the areas of Stroke (CVA), Multiple Sclerosis (MS), Post-Polio Syndrome, Complex Foot and Ankle, Spinal Cord Injuries and Diabetic Feet.

Kunal’s vision is to provide exceptional orthotics services to all patients and to go above and beyond for patients.

Kunal’s goal is to create awareness among the community and other health professionals that a great orthotics service can make a big difference to patients’ lifestyle and they don’t have to settle for less.

Kunal is the Member of Australian Orthotics and Prosthetics Association (AOPA) and accredited every year.
